NUnit Samples
This directory contains sample applications demonstrating the use of NUnit and organized as follows...
CSharp: Samples in C#
Failures: Demonstrates 4 failing tests and one that is not run.
Money: This is a C# version of the money example which is found in most xUnit implementations. Thanks to Kent Beck.
Money-Port: This shows how the Money example can be ported from Version 1 of NUnit with minimal changes.
Syntax: Illustrates most Assert methods using both the classic and constraint-based syntax.
JSharp: Samples in J#
Failures: Demonstrates 4 failing tests and one that is not run.
CPP: C++ Samples
MANAGED: Managed C++ Samples (VS 2003 compatible)
Failures: Demonstrates 4 failing tests and one that is not run.
CPP-CLI: C++/CLI Samples (VS 2005 only)
Failures: Demonstrates 4 failing tests and one that is not run.
Syntax: Illustrates most Assert methods using both the classic and constraint-based syntax.
VB: Samples in VB.NET
Failures: Demonstrates 4 failing tests and one that is not run.
Money: This is a VB.NET version of the money example found in most xUnit implementations. Thanks to Kent Beck.
Syntax: Illustrates most Assert methods using both the classic and constraint-based syntax.
Extensibility: Examples of extending NUnit
Framework:
Core:
TestSuiteExtension
TestFixtureExtension
Building the Samples
A Visual Studio 2003 project is included for most samples.
Visual Studio 2005 will convert the format automatically upon
opening it. The C++/CLI samples, as well as other samples that
depend on .NET 2.0 features, include Visual Studio 2005 projects.
In most cases, you will need to remove the reference to the
nunit.framework assembly and replace it with a reference to
your installed copy of NUnit.
To build using the Microsoft compiler, use a command similar
to the following:
csc /target:library /r:<path-to-NUnit>/nunit.framework.dll example.cs
To build using the mono compiler, use a command like this:
msc /target:library /r:<path-to-NUNit>/nunit.framework.dll example.cs
没有合适的资源?快使用搜索试试~ 我知道了~
基于C#实现的NUnit-2.5[2008-04-07-src]测试代码工具源代码
共962个文件
cs:574个
csproj:91个
html:74个
需积分: 0 9 下载量 123 浏览量
2008-10-09
09:58:57
上传
评论
收藏 1.75MB ZIP 举报
温馨提示
基于C#实现的NUnit-2.5[2008-04-07-src]测试代码工具源代码。
资源详情
资源评论
资源推荐
收起资源包目录
基于C#实现的NUnit-2.5[2008-04-07-src]测试代码工具源代码 (962个子文件)
clr.bat 3KB
Install.bat 1KB
nunit.build 33KB
nunit.uikit.build 5KB
nunit.core.build 4KB
nunit.util.build 4KB
nunit.core.tests.build 4KB
nunit.framework.build 4KB
nunit.util.tests.build 3KB
SampleFixtureExtension.build 3KB
SampleSuiteExtension.build 3KB
nunit-gui.build 3KB
nunit.framework.tests.build 3KB
MaxTimeDecorator.build 3KB
nunit.core.interfaces.build 3KB
test-assembly.build 2KB
cpp-managed-failures.build 2KB
nunit-console.exe.build 2KB
nunit.uikit.tests.build 2KB
cs-money-port.build 2KB
nunit-gui.exe.build 2KB
Minimal.build 2KB
vb-money.build 2KB
cpp-cli-failures.build 2KB
nunit.fixtures.build 2KB
cpp-cli-syntax.build 2KB
vb-syntax.build 2KB
vb-failures.build 2KB
cs-money.build 1KB
nunit.framework.extensions.build 1KB
jsharp-failures.build 1KB
cs-failures.build 1KB
cs-syntax.build 1KB
nunit.extensions.tests.build 1KB
nunit.mocks.build 1KB
nunit-console.tests.build 1KB
test-utilities.build 1KB
nunit-console.build 1KB
nunit.core.extensions.build 1KB
nunit-gui.tests.build 1KB
nunit-agent.exe.build 1KB
nunit.fixtures.tests.build 1KB
timing-tests.build 1KB
nunit.mocks.tests.build 1005B
nunit-server.exe.build 976B
mock-assembly.build 873B
nonamespace-assembly.build 818B
loadtest-assembly.build 712B
App.config 4KB
App.config 4KB
NUnitTests.config 4KB
App.config 4KB
NUnitTests.config 3KB
NUnitTests.config 3KB
runFile.exe.config 2KB
nunit21under22.config 958B
nunit20under22.config 958B
nunit20under21.config 950B
cs-money-port.dll.config 477B
cpp-cli-syntax.cpp 19KB
AssemblyInfo.cpp 2KB
AssemblyInfo.cpp 2KB
AssemblyInfo.cpp 1KB
cppsample.cpp 1KB
cppsample.cpp 1KB
Assert.cs 129KB
NUnitForm.cs 60KB
ProjectEditor.cs 39KB
TestSuiteTreeView.cs 39KB
AssertSyntaxTests.cs 28KB
CollectionAssert.cs 27KB
TestTree.cs 27KB
AssertSyntaxTests.cs 26KB
DirectoryAssert.cs 25KB
TestPropertiesDialog.cs 21KB
TestLoader.cs 19KB
TextOutputSettingsPage.cs 17KB
ExpectExceptionTest.cs 17KB
Reflect.cs 17KB
NUnitTestCaseBuilder.cs 16KB
TextMessageWriter.cs 15KB
CollectionAssertTest.cs 15KB
EqualConstraint.cs 15KB
DirectoryAssertTests.cs 15KB
ErrorDisplay.cs 14KB
ResultTabs.cs 14KB
ConstraintBuilder.cs 13KB
NUnitFramework.cs 13KB
FileAssert.cs 13KB
EqualsFixture.cs 13KB
SetupFixtureTests.cs 12KB
TestResult.cs 12KB
NUnitProject.cs 12KB
FileAssertTests.cs 11KB
TestSuite.cs 11KB
TestLoaderUI.cs 11KB
TestMethod.cs 10KB
TestSuiteTest.cs 10KB
FixtureSetUpTearDownTest.cs 10KB
TestSuiteTreeViewFixture.cs 10KB
共 962 条
- 1
- 2
- 3
- 4
- 5
- 6
- 10
领君2018
- 粉丝: 204
- 资源: 1527
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0